Chad Gable looks to be positioned for a meaningful spot heading into SummerSlam. Now back under his own name after dropping the El Grande Americano gimmick, Gable appears to be in a good spot creatively. There's said to be strong internal support for him, with multiple people backstage reportedly pushing for him to get a prominent role at SummerSlam, which lands in his hometown of Minneapolis this year. The momentum follows a months-long run as the masked El Grande Americano, a character that drew plenty of fan buzz and apparently moved some merch along the way.
